Randomly BSOD after upgrading my pc

Hi,

For the last week I've regularly had varying blue screen error codes while using my PC.

I've used the SFC, DISM and CHKDSK commands to no avail. i've also uninstall graphic driver using DDU, update to latest driver

but no clue.. my PC still BSOD Randomly..

there is my dump files, please help me, thank you

Hi, thank you for that information, no need for the third-party software to download driver, since the issue persists after doing the steps above and as per checking the event logs and still have the same error, kindly download and install the latest BIOS update from your manufacturer's website, moreover, if the issue persists, we will check and make sure there are no software-related issue, I suggest doing an in-place upgrade wherein it will upgrade the device to the latest version and repair all issues without deleting any files.

Kindly follow the steps from this link:
https://answers.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/for...

Note: If the issue persists, I suggest contacting a local technician to physically check the processor or do a re-pasting of thermal paste to optimize the processor.
